Transaction 66421daf3f8a3a4ffe4e23937c02cd678ef1e77e61f6b876834ab5f376e52a80

1 Input
2 Outputs
  • 66421daf3f8a3a4ffe4e23937c02cd678ef1e77e61f6b876834ab5f376e52a80:0
  • value  140939716
    address  1LcaLpgsov3VPBGtcRPabbfRKezNaxXPUB
  • 66421daf3f8a3a4ffe4e23937c02cd678ef1e77e61f6b876834ab5f376e52a80:1
  • value  611523114
    address  13FpT8f87GBB4VMDfmgXz5F9Z1xRJgTWZL